Integrated campaign embraces positivity for Child Health Plus plans.

Child Health Plus is a health insurance plan for kids and teens sponsored by the State of New York. While the program and plan design remain essentially identical across carriers, regional health insurer MVP Health Care felt they could bring more to the table. They were looking to raise awareness of the MVP Child Health Plus plan availability and MVP value proposition.

Media Logic and MVP landed on a fun, fresh approach based on the notion that “every kid deserves super health care” – modified slightly to “every kid deserves awesome health care” for the pre-teen/teen audience.

The bright, colorful campaign included TV, radio, out-of-home, print, paid search, paid social, and a dedicated landing page (with incorporated video). We also developed a new Child Health Plus-only shopping experience on the MVP main site to help people better understand eligibility and the costs for child-only coverage.

The end result was an integrated, upbeat effort that made a strong case for MVP while helping to overcome some of the stigma that can be associated with government-sponsored programs.

Forward-Flow Funding: Right Solution, Right Time

Forward-Flow Funding: Right Solution, Right Time

It starts with a non-traditional premise: forward-flow funding is based on a company's anticipated future, not traditional assets or credit history. Instead of assessing credit scores, loan eligibility and amounts are determined through a business's projected revenue and cash flow statements. The SBO benefits from a steady source of funds, and the lender enjoys a predictable stream of assets.
